ECU是ABS系统的大脑。它处理来自轮速感知器的资料并做出快速决策来调节煞车压力。 ECU 技术的进步包括更快的处理速度、改进的演算法和增强的诊断功能,从而实现更精确和更灵敏的煞车控制。
这些感测器可监控每个车轮的转速。它们向 ECU 提供关键资料,使其能够检测车轮锁死并相应地调整煞车压力。目前的趋势集中在开发更准确、更耐用的轮速感知器以增强 ABS 性能。
液压调製器控制每个车轮的煞车液压。它由快速打开和关闭以调节煞车压力的电磁阀组成。此组件的趋势涉及先进材料的使用和设计最佳化,以提高压力调製的速度和精度。
帮浦和马达组件负责维持适当的煞车油压力。它确保 ABS 系统即使在不同的条件下也能发挥最佳功能。该组件的进步旨在提高能源效率、降低噪音并提高耐用性。
煞车管路的完整性和液压油的品质对于 ABS 性能至关重要。该领域的趋势集中在开发用于煞车管路的耐腐蚀材料和能够承受极端温度并提供一致煞车的高性能液压油。
阀门和执行器在控制煞车压力方面发挥关键作用。阀门技术的进步涉及轻质材料的使用和紧凑的设计,以减轻 ABS 系统的整体重量并提高响应能力。
可靠的连接器和接线对于保持 ABS 讯号和资料传输的完整性至关重要。该领域的趋势着重于增强耐用性和对环境因素的抵抗力,确保长期性能。
现代 ABS 系统包括诊断和通讯接口,可实现即时监控以及与其他车辆系统的通讯。该领域的趋势包括改进的连接选项和为技术人员提供更用户友好的诊断工具。

The ECU is the brain of the ABS system. It processes data from wheel speed sensors and makes rapid decisions to modulate brake pressure. Advances in ECU technology include faster processing speeds, improved algorithms, and enhanced diagnostic capabilities, allowing for more precise and responsive braking control.
These sensors monitor the rotational speed of each wheel. They provide critical data to the ECU, enabling it to detect wheel lockup and adjust brake pressure accordingly. Ongoing trends focus on the development of more accurate and durable wheel speed sensors to enhance ABS performance.
The hydraulic modulator controls brake fluid pressure to each wheel. It consists of solenoid valves that open and close rapidly to regulate brake pressure. Trends in this component involve the use of advanced materials and design optimization to improve the speed and precision of pressure modulation.
The pump and motor assembly is responsible for maintaining proper brake fluid pressure. It ensures that the ABS system can function optimally even under varying conditions. Advances in this component aim to enhance energy efficiency, reduce noise, and increase durability.
The integrity of brake lines and the quality of hydraulic fluid are critical for ABS performance. Trends in this segment focus on the development of corrosion-resistant materials for brake lines and high-performance hydraulic fluids that can withstand extreme temperatures and provide consistent braking.
Valves and actuators play a key role in controlling brake pressure. Advances in valve technology involve the use of lightweight materials and compact designs to reduce the overall weight of the ABS system and improve responsiveness.
Reliable connectors and wiring are essential for maintaining the integrity of ABS signals and data transmission. Trends in this segment focus on enhanced durability and resistance to environmental factors, ensuring long-term performance.
Modern ABS systems include diagnostic and communication interfaces that allow for real-time monitoring and communication with other vehicle systems. Trends in this area involve improved connectivity options and more user-friendly diagnostic tools for technicians.
To enhance overall safety, some ABS systems incorporate sensor fusion technology. This involves the integration of data from multiple sensors, such as wheel speed sensors, steering angle sensors, and yaw rate sensors, to provide a more comprehensive picture of vehicle dynamics. The trend is toward more advanced sensor fusion algorithms to improve ABS performance in diverse driving conditions.
